Amitabh Bachchan enquires about K-pop is on KBC for Rs 5,000

On his quiz show Kaun Banega Crorepati, Amitabh Bachchan gained some insight into the K-Pop explosion. In a recent show, he quizzed a contestant on BTS in exchange for a Rs 5,000 award. He posed the question, “The band BTS, with Jin, Suga, and J-Hope as three of its members, is from which Asian country?,” in a video that went viral after the episode. South Korea was one of the choices. B. Iran C. Mongolia, and D. Sri Lanka. The candidate gave a prompt response to the query. Amitabh Bachchan observed the contestant’s eager expression while answering and was impressed.

When she provided the right response, Big B said that BTS stands for Bangtan Sonyeondan. I adore K-Pop, sir, she replied. She went on to explain that K-Pop is Korean music because Amitabh didn’t know what the phrase meant, to which he replied that he had learned “something new.”

Naturally, Desi ARMY was ecstatic and posted on Twitter to celebrate the fact that BTS had made it onto the well-known programme. One person said, “There’s no way they brought up BTS in KBC. Jimin’s birthday is today, so this made my day. BTS will soon be in textbooks, according to some.
